#579c9a h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#579c9a is composed of 34.1% red, 61.2% green and 60.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 1.3%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 178.3 degrees, a saturation of 28.4% and a lightness of 47.6%. #579c9a color hex could be obtained by blending #aeffff with #003935.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

● #579c9a color description : Mostly desaturated dark cyan.
The hexadecimal color #579c9a has RGB values of R:87, G:156, B:154 and CMYK values of C:0.44, M:0, Y:0.01,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 5741722.
